What's The Definition Of Bullock?
[n] castrated bull
[n] young bull Synonyms | Synonyms for Bullock: steer Related Terms | Find terms related to Bullock: See Also | Bos taurus | bull | cattle | cows | kine | oxen Bullock In Webster's Dictionary \Bul"lock\, n. [AS. bulluc a young bull. See {Bull}.]
1. A young bull, or any male of the ox kind.
Take thy father's young bullock, even the second
bullock of seven years old. --Judges vi.
25.
2. An ox, steer, or stag.
\Bul"lock\, v. t. To bully. [Obs.] She shan't think to bullock and domineer over me. --Foote. |
